Calendula-infused olive oil – traditionally used to comfort delicate skin
Yarrow – historically valued for supporting skin tone
St. John’s wort – known in herbal traditions for soothing properties
Witch hazel (oil infusion) – gently calming and toning
Shea butter – deeply nourishing barrier support
Lavender + peppermint – subtle cooling refresh
Each ingredient was chosen to support tender postpartum skin with calm, not overwhelm.
For Perineal Area:
A little goes a long way.
After using the bathroom:
• Gently pat dry
• Apply a small amount to clean fingers
• Lightly apply to the outer perineal area
• Use daily for comfort + cooling support. Especially comforting after cleansing or sitz bath
For Incision Area:
⚠️ Important: Do NOT apply directly on an open incision.
• Apply a small amount around the incision, not directly on it
• Gently massage surrounding skin to support circulation
Think: support the tissue around it , not the wound itself..
For Hemorrhoids or Rectal Pressure
- Apply externally only
For added cooling, store balm in refrigerator
